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ask La Junta). They breezed past the Manitou Springs Mustangs to the tune of 63-13 on Friday. With the Tigers ahead 49-7 at the half, the game was all but over already.
La Junta didn't go easy on the quarterback and picked off two passes before the game was over. The picks came courtesy of Christian Armendariz and Calvin Hill.
Despite the loss, Manitou Springs still got an impressive performance from Dillon Gates, who rushed for 33 yards and a pair of touchdowns.
The victory made it two in a row for La Junta and bumps their season record up to 4-2. The wins came thanks in part to their defensive effort, having only surrendered a grand total of 25 points in those games. As for Manitou Springs, they are on a six-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 0-6.
